Lift and Shift SAS Datasets and Scripts to Snowflake

5/23/20262 min read

geometric shape digital wallpaper
geometric shape digital wallpaper

Introduction to Data Migration

Data migration is a critical process for organizations aiming to enhance their data management capabilities. In recent years, the demand for cloud-based solutions has escalated, making platforms like Snowflake a popular choice for data warehousing. This blog post focuses on the 'lift and shift' strategy, specifically regarding SAS datasets and SAS scripts migrating to Snowflake without necessitating manual remediation.

Understanding Lift and Shift in Data Migration

The 'lift and shift' methodology refers to the direct transfer of datasets and scripts from one environment to another. This process is particularly advantageous in reducing downtime and minimizing the complexity often associated with traditional data migration methods. By leveraging Snowflake's scalable architecture, organizations can seamlessly adapt their existing SAS environments, enabling them to capitalize on cloud efficiencies.

Steps for Effective Migration

To successfully execute a lift and shift migration of SAS datasets and scripts to Snowflake, businesses should follow a structured approach. The key steps include:

  • Assessment: Evaluate existing SAS datasets and scripts to identify dependencies and data quality requirements.
  • Preparation: Establish a Snowflake account and configure the necessary environments to ensure compatibility with SAS data structures.
  • Execution: Migrate the datasets using automated tools, ensuring that SAS scripts are adjusted as needed to fit within Snowflake's operational parameters.
  • Validation: After migration, conduct thorough testing to ascertain data integrity, performance metrics, and functional operation of SAS scripts in the Snowflake environment.

By adhering to these steps, organizations can facilitate an efficient lift and shift data migration process, minimizing the potential for errors or required manual interventions.

Benefits of Migrating SAS to Snowflake

Utilizing Snowflake for SAS datasets and scripts offers multiple benefits. Firstly, Snowflake supports both structured and semi-structured data, which means it can handle a variety of SAS data types without requiring extensive reformatting. Additionally, Snowflake's architecture allows for horizontal scalability, which can accommodate increased data loads seamlessly. This flexibility enables organizations to perform data analytics more effectively while optimizing storage costs.

In conclusion, the lift and shift strategy presents a viable path for transitioning SAS datasets and scripts to a Snowflake environment. This approach not only preserves data integrity but also capitalizes on the powerful capabilities and features that Snowflake offers. By implementing an automated migration with strategic planning, organizations can achieve successful data transitions, paving the way for advanced data utilization in the cloud.

a blue background with lines and dots